    It's great for all ages. You can take the cable car all the way to the top (about 3 euros one way or 5 both ways) and then it's a 10min walk to "Belvedere" where the view is amazing. You can see Brasov from above and then, either take a walk back to the bottom (also with a choice between stairs or road) or take the cable car back.

    Tampa Hill is located above the town of Brasov and offers a magnificent view of the entire town and its surroundings. You can climb it on foot or take the cable car up or down. The cable car ride is very fast, it takes about two minutes. But be prepared, there might be a long queue of people waiting for the cable car ride.

    Stunning view! Worth walking down to the city instead if taking the cabled car. The path with flowers and butterflies is not a very hard route, even for those with little to no physical training at all. There are also benches and resting places along the way, as well as information panels. The walk down usually takes between 1.5-3 hours.

    Given the fact there was quite a large queue for the cable car, we opted to hike up and back. The hike starts a few minutes walk away from the cable car, either side. Well worth doing the hike, steep in places but not too difficult. I would allow an hour going the direct route. We took a longer route around the back and took approximately 90mins. Amazing views of the city and would highly recommend making it up no matter what way you decide.
